Dakota Supply Group (DSG) is seeking a CDL Class A Delivery Driver in our Grand Rapids, MN location. In this full time, hourly position, work is typically performed between the hours of 7am and 5pm, Monday through Friday, but may vary on occasion according to business needs. As a CDL Delivery Driver, you will work in all aspects of warehouse operations, with the primary duty of delivering product to customers and jobsites, which includes the loading, unloading, securing and transporting of such materials.

The CDL Class A Delivery Driver must hold a valid Class A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) with current medical card.

A Typical Day in the Life of a CDL Class A Delivery Driver at DSG:

  • Load delivery truck in a safe manner, according to company policy
  • Work with warehouse associates to communicate how product should be loaded
  • Inspect truck & trailer according to company policy and DOT standards, to ensure it is in good working order
  • Immediately communicate any vehicle safety and/or maintenance issues to the supervisor
  • Communicate with customers regarding delivery dates & times
  • Drive to various customer locations, typically within 150 miles of branch location
  • Unload materials at customers’ places of businesses and/or warehouses, as per customer instruction
  • Stay compliant with DOT/FMCSA and OSHA regulations including completion of training activities as required by DSG policy and/or regulatory authorities
  • Adhere to DSG’s safety policy and vehicle safety program
  • Maintain a good driving record
  • Assist in all aspects of warehouse operations when not out on delivery:
    1. Accurately pull product to fill orders in a timely manner
    2. Pack, label and put filled orders in proper locations for delivery
    3. Operate forklift
    4. Use computer and RF scanner to check on status, availability and location of product
  • Perform other duties as assigned

A Successful CDL Class A Delivery Driver Typically Has:

  • A valid Class A CDL with current medical card (required).
  • Basic product and warehouse/delivery knowledge normally acquired in one to three years of applicable experience.
  • Attention to detail.
  • The ability to plan, prioritize and organize work effectively to work efficiently under pressure and time deadlines.
  • Safety training on material handling and forklift driving.
  • Strong interpersonal, customer service, and communication skills.
  • A physical ability to lift, push, pull or move items weighing 70-325lbs. with the aid of mechanical device or another person.
  • Prior computer knowledge, experience, and skills.
